When to Cover Your Pool

The ideal time to cover your pool for winter depends on your location and the average temperature in your area. If you live in a region with frosty winters, it's recommended to cover your pool when the temperature drops below 60°F (15°C). Think of it like putting your pool to bed for the winter - you want to make sure it's all snug and cozy before the cold weather sets in.

But, what if you live in a milder climate, where the winters are relatively mild? In that case, you might not need to cover your pool at all, or you might only need to cover it during the coldest months.
